Tripods
A common issue with visual recordings is shakes or unstable video content. Viewers want steady images.
One simple solution is to invest in either a monopod or a tripod. Options range from smaller sizes like the Celly Squiddy Flexible Mini Tripod to more sophisticated options like the FeiyuTech Scorp Pro 3 Axis Handheld Gimbal for DSLR.

Lumen5
Lumen5 allows content creators to generate exciting videos and social media posts. This company, already known for its video content tools, allows using features powered by Artificial Intelligence.
The basic option lets users make up to five videos per month free, then costs can start at $10 USD for additional output. Video production time will drop drastically, meaning it gets made far faster. There is support for many platforms including iPhone and Android mobile options.

Popular Project Management Systems
There are many different project management systems around. Commonly used ones include Monday.com, Trello, Asana, Jira and Click Up. These days most are incorporating the use of AI efficiencies and intuitive behaviour to make the interface and UX experience easier.
